集群内核节点查看命令linux
集群内核节点查看命令linux怎么做?根据CSDN博客作者zerowin的分享,查看Linux内核版本的命令可以使用以下两种方法:
第一种
cat /version [root@S-CentOShome]# cat /version Linux version 2.6.32-431.el6.x86_64 (mockbuild@) (gcc version 4.4.7 20120313 (Red Hat4.4.7-4) (GCC) ) #1 SMP Fri Nov 22 03:15:09 UTC 2013
第二种
uname -a [root@S-CentOS home]# uname -a Linux S-CentOS 2.6.32-431.el6.x86_64 #1 SMP Fri Nov 22 03:15:09 UTC 2013 x86_64 x86_64 x86_64 /Linux
以docker为例,底层的核心技术包括Libcontainer(LXC),这是一种内核虚拟化技术,可以提供轻量级的虚拟化,以便隔离进程和资源。LXC的两大组件包括命名空间以及控制组。
命名空间(Namespaces)是Linux内核一个强大的特性。每个容器都有自己单独的命名空间,运行在其中的应用都像是在独立的操作系统中运行一样。命名空间保证了容器之间彼此互不影响,包含容器间PID资源隔离、网络隔离、IPC资源隔离、文件目录隔离、主机名和域名隔离、用户和组的隔离。
控制组(cgroups)主要用来对共享资源进行隔离、限制、审计等。只有能控制分配到容器的资源,才能避免当多个容器同时运行时的对系统资源的竞争。可对容器使用的CPU、内存和网络等资源进行管理控制。
融亿云的容器云产品拥有上万Linux镜像,轻松组建服务集群,自行DIY选择网络计费方式,支持按带宽或按流量计费,私有网络免费,具备超高性价比。产品链接